Middlesbrough sign Fabio da Silva from Cardiff City

Middlesbrough have signed former Manchester United defender Fabio da Silva from Cardiff City for an undisclosed fee.

The 26-year-old moves to the newly-promoted Premier League outfit on a two-year deal that will keep him at the Riverside Stadium until 2018.

The Brazilian has previous experience of top-flight football from his time with Manchester United and Queens Park Rangers in addition to Cardiff.

Boro reportedly triggered Fabio's release clause before entering personal terms with the full-back, who becomes Aitor Karanka's seventh signing of the summer.

Fabio made 68 appearances for the Bluebirds, scoring one goal.
